BOYS' CLUB BASKETBALL: Our Boys' Basketball Club program was limited to the first 300 total registrants for the 8/9 and 10/11 club leagues, and additionally limited to the first 300 total registrants for the 12/13 and 14-18 club leagues. This was due to facility limitations in the area.

Anyone that registered after the first 300 in either (8/9 & 10/11) or (12/13 & 14/18) will be placed on a waiting list. Those on the waiting list will be placed in the order registrations were received. As a space becomes available players will be contacted.

Players will be contacted in early November for their player evaluation times. A player must be evaluated in order to be placed on a team. Players not showing up for evaluations may not be placed on a team.

BOYS' SELECT BASKETBALL:Boys desiring to play SELECT Basketball MUST register as SELECT players (and pay the necessary fees) and MUST do so before the Winter registration deadline. The SELECT registration information will be used to contact players for SELECT evaluations and keep them informed of the process. Accordingly, players signing up for Club Basketball will NOT be notified of SELECT evaluation times. Players not making these teams will be given a refund of the difference between CLUB and SELECT fees and will be registered to play CLUB basketball (unless otherwise directed by the player and/or parents of the player).

ABOUT THE PROGRAM

OVERVIEW: Currently the Boys' Basketball program runs during the fall and winter seasons. Historically there has not been sufficient interest to run leagues of multiple teams at any of the age groups in the spring or summer. If there are individual Select teams that want to continue practicing or playing league games in the non-winter seasons, they can contact one of the Select Program Director.

No specialized equipment or training is needed to participate in the Green Hornets Boys Basketball program; just bring a pair of basketball shoes, practice attire, and a desire to learn and have fun.

Each year we strive to improve the program. Improvements this year will include the enhancement of a Referee training and development program. Past improvements, including the hiring of professional referees for the older Club program, the purchase of reversible NBA jerseys for club teams, training and development for coaches, a Fall Clinic and the purchase of electronic scoreboards, will continue.

“Respect our Facilities”. In the past our use of county gym space has been jeopardized when unsupervised players or siblings have caused damage to the facilities. We have tried various programs to address this issue in the past, with limited success. The following rules must be adhered to by all participants in the Green Hornets Boys' Basketball program or they will risk dismissal from the program:

  • No players are to be left unsupervised in the county facilities. If a coach or assistant coach from the player's team is not present in the building, the player is not to be left without an adult.
  • Siblings are not permitted to attend practices or games without adult supervision. Siblings who are roaming the halls, stages or cafeterias of the facilities will be asked to leave the facility with their chaperone.
  • In the facilities where the floor is carpeted (e.g., Shipley's Choice Elementary and Severna Park Elementary), players must leave their water bottles outside the gym or use the water fountains at the school for hydration…
  • Parents should NOT bring coffee into our gyms at ANY TIME…
It will be incumbent upon the players, the coaches, and the players' parents to work together to make sure that the facilities are left in the same or better condition than when they arrived, and that no "horseplay" occurs. It is imperative that parents not bring siblings to games or practices if they cannot be supervised at all times during their stay in the facility.

AGE RANGE: Players range in age from 8- to 17-years old.

COST: Local (Club) Basketball $100 / Select (County) Basketball $150

SEASON: The season for boys' basketball runs from mid-November to early March.
